  • #11: From OJ Simpson Case to Best Selling Author - Marcia Clark Shares Latest Real Crime Book Release and How Resilience Is Key to Success and Reinvention
    Marcia Clark, best known as the lead prosecutor in the O.J. Simpson trial, has become a trailblazer for women in law and beyond. Her journey from courtroom to bestselling author reflects her resilience and determination to redefine herself amidst intense public scrutiny. On this episode of Worth Knowing, Clark dives into her latest book, *Trial by Ambush*, which examines the 1953 Barbara Graham case—a story that highlights gender bias, media sensationalism, and the notion that all cases are subject to societal, cultural, and political winds. Clark shares how her experiences during the Simpson trial shaped her perspective on societal pressures and the role of women in high-stakes professions. Her reflections on how media, forensic science, and legal practices have evolved over decades offer valuable insights into the intersection of law and culture. This conversation is a compelling exploration of true crime, personal growth, and how Clark’s groundbreaking career continues to inspire a new generation of women to challenge norms and forge their own paths. Marcia Clark is a bestselling author and a criminal lawyer who began her career in law as a criminal defense attorney and went on to become a prosecutor in the L.A. District Attorney's Office in 1981. She spent ten years in the Special Trials Unit, where she handled a number of high-profile cases, including the prosecution of stalker/murderer Robert Bardo, whose conviction for the murder of actress Rebecca Schaeffer resulted in legislation that offered victims better protection from stalkers as well as increased punishment for the offenders. She was lead prosecutor for the O.J. Simpson murder trial. In May of 1997 her book on the Simpson case, "Without a Doubt," was published and reached #1 on the New York Times, Wall St. Journal, Washington Post, Los Angeles Times, and Publishers Weekly bestsellers lists. In February 2016, Clark re-released the book with a new foreword.   • #8: Dare to Disrupt: How Hint Founder Kara Goldin Turns Challenges into Opportunities
    Kara Goldin is a powerhouse entrepreneur who transformed her health journey into Hint, a revolutionary unsweetened flavored water brand that's now a staple in Silicon Valley's top companies like Google and Facebook and in stores across the country. From her days as an AOL executive to becoming the founder of a multi-million beverage company, Kara embodies the spirit of an "accidental entrepreneur" who turned personal wellness into a game-changing business. She's bold, relentlessly curious, and proof that asking the right questions that can disrupt entire industries - in her case, creating a healthy alternative to sugary drinks. On this episode of Worth Knowing, we dive deep into her incredible story of how she went from drinking 10-12 diet sodas a day to launching Hint, a brand that's about much more than water. Entrepreneurs, get ready, because you will take away nearly a dozen key insights on how to reach your personal and professional North Star.  Kara Goldin is the Founder of Hint, Inc., best known for its award-winning Hint water, the leading unsweetened flavored water. Kara was the CEO of Hint for 17 years and is still a proud member of the board.  She has received numerous accolades, including being named EY Entrepreneur of the Year 2017 Northern California and one ofInStyle’s 2019 Badass 50. Previously, Kara was VP of Shopping Partnerships at America Online. She hosts the podcast The Kara Goldin Show and her first book, Undaunted: Overcoming Doubts and Doubters, was released October 2020 and is now a WSJ and Amazon Best Seller.  Kara lives in the Bay Area with her family and 3 labradors.   • #7: Three Ways To Embrace Your Inner Drive to Become a Successful Entrepreneur
    Shirah Benarde was 16 when she and her brother beat out 40,000 others to appear on Shark Tank with her innovative product that battles a growing problem. It is called Nightcap - a drink protection cover. Millions in sales later, Shirah shares her personal experience and middle-of-the-night "ah ha" dream that turned her vision into a mission that has not only turned into a profitable business but has helped shape legislation to protect young people. Shirah Benarde might be only 22 years old, but she has already helped keep over half a million people safe from drink spiking with her viral company NightCap. NightCap is a revolutionary brand that was featured on Shark Tank in 2021, resulting in a passionate partnership with Lori Greiner.    Since NightCap's inception, Shirah has not saved just one person, but over HALF A MILLION people worldwide. She has ignited movements for drink safety, speaking at global conferences and informing and advocating for legislation (including a new bill in California) to help prevent spiking.
